Bumps net.jqwik:jqwik from 1.8.+ to 1.9.0.

Release notes

Sourced from net.jqwik:jqwik's releases.

Kotlin 2.0 and Nullability Annotations

New and Enhanced Features

  • Upgraded to Kotlin 2.0.0

  • Upgraded to JUnit Platform 1.10.3

Breaking Changes

  • StatisticsCoverage.checkQuery(Predicate<? super List<?>> query): query is now of type Predicate<? super List<?>> instead of Predicate<? super List<Object>>.

  • Nullability annotations have been added to many API methods and interfaces. This could lead to compile-time warnings or errors in your code if you are using tool chains that validate those.

  • UniqueElements.by() now requires a Class<? extends Function<? extends @Nullable Object, ?>> instead of a Class<? extends Function<?, Object>>.

Bug Fixes

  • Tools like CheckerFramework did not play well with jqwik's (wrong) usage of @Nullable on type variables. This has been fixed. See issue 575 for details. Thanks to vlsi for working out all the nitty, gritty details!

  • Fixed type matching bug as revealed in this comment
